How It Begins

You are an adventurer carrying nothing. After complaining about the "City of Doors", you leapt through a portal and arrived in an abandoned study containing no doors or exits of any kind. All you see are a writing desk (with a brassy key on it), a fireplace, and empty bookshelves. Perhaps your complaints about doors, like the doors themselves, were misplaced.

Notable Features

  • Portable doors. Doors can be placed on walls to create a new connection between your current room and an adjacent room. Note, however, that these doors have a directional aspect. East doors can only go on east walls, south doors can only go on south walls, and so on.

    • Note that this game was intended to be a participant in the 2019 IF Advent Calendar project, but the project was never completed, so the game was released independently in 2020.
